		<description>That may be true. Alexa rank measures traffic to a site (as in number of visitors). Page rank is a measure of page &quot;popularity&quot; on the web. Both these measure different aspects of a page/site. Since Alexa rank does not imply higher PR, it may not be a factor in SEO.</description>
